Derry Girls demolished as Kilkenny camogie Cats storm into knockout stages

by on the 29th of June 2024

Glen Dimplex Senior All Ireland Championship

Kilkenny 4-17

Derry 0-7

By Aoife Lanigan, PRO

Kilkenny will play Tipperary next Saturday with direct progression to the semi-finals as group winners up for grabs after making sure of qualification to the knockout stages by blitzing last year’s intermediate champions Derry in Freshford.

Straight from the throw-in, Kilkenny went on the attack. Julianne Malone gave them a perfect start when she quickly rifled the sliotar to the Derry net.

Aimee Lennon hit back with a point from play for Derry. Miriam Walsh added a point for Kilkenny, before Derry’s free taker Aine Barton hit over a point. That was as good as it got for the visitors as Kilkenny scored the next five points through Aoife Doyle and Aoife Prendergast (four frees) to march into a 1-6 to 0-3 lead

The home side kept the pressure on, Aoife Doyle striking a smart point over her shoulder in the 27th minute following Steffi Fitzgerald’s inch-perfect pass. Katie Nolan finished the first half scoring with a point to leave Kilkenny comfortable at the break (1-8 to 0-3).

The winners picked up where they had left off after the restart, Aoife Prendergast slotting over a lovely point from play. Aine Barton hit the next two points from frees for Derry, but Steffi Fitzgerald hit back with a nice point for Kilkenny.

With 37 minutes on the clock an Aoife Doyle goal saw Kilkenny put the tie to bed. The Cats opened up from there, hitting the next five points through Katie Nolan (3), Sophie O’Dwyer and Aoife Doyle.

Aine Barton stopped the rot with a pointed free for Derry before Kilkenny let rip again. Asha McHardy scored a fine point before Prendergast pounced for two goals in as many minutes, bringing her tally to 2-5.

Aine Barton (free) and Steffi Fitzgerald traded points, but Kilkenny were already assured of a big win.
